     How to draw a cartoon Butterfly step by step

    Please see the drawing tutorial in the video below

    You can refer to the simple step-by-step drawing guide below

    Step 1:

    body
    Start by drawing a long oval.

    This will be the body of your butterfly.

    You want to aim for a fairly elongated oval.

    If you draw an oval that looks similar to a circle, you will end up with a very chubby butterfly.

    Step 2:

    head & beard
    For the head, you want to draw a circle above your oval.

    Try to make the radius of your circle equal or smaller than the small radius of the oval.

    Meaning you don’t want your head to be wider than your body.

    Then add two whiskers on top.

    In fact, these beards are almost straight. But I always like to paint them with an extra curl at the end.

    Doesn’t that make them much cuter?

    Step 3:

    wing border
    The wings are the most distinctive feature of butterflies. And honestly, you can draw them however you want!

    For this example, I drew 4 separate wings. Normally the upper wings are larger than the lower ones.

    The butterfly I drew is quite easy because it resembles a rectangle.

    The hard part is drawing both the left and right sides similarly. This may take a few tries. So let’s start with thin lines!

    Step 4:

    decorate your first wing
    Okay, now comes the fun part: drawing the pattern on the wings.

    In nature, butterfly patterns are usually made up of straight lines, circles, and dark edges.

    So for my butterfly I make sure to use lots of circles.

    But for your butterfly, you can use whatever you want.

    Step 5:

    Reflect your design
    Now that you’ve completed your first wing, you’ve come to the hardest part.

    You will have to do the same pattern on the opposite wing.

    Depending on the complexity of your first wing, this can be pretty easy or extremely difficult.

    You may want to use a ruler to come up with some guidelines to help show where things should go.

    Step 6:

    lower wing decoration
    Now you can repeat the process for the lower wings.

    The upper and lower wings do not have to be the same. But normally they look pretty similar.

    That’s why I chose to use some more circles.

    Now that you have finished drawing your butterfly, you can color it however you want.

    How to draw a butterfly

    Please see the drawing tutorial in the video below

    You can refer to the simple step-by-step drawing guide below

    Step 1

    First draw the body. There are two long thin oval segments. The top segment is shorter than the bottom segment.

    Step 2

    Now draw the left wing. The top of the wing is triangular in shape. It’s attached to the top segment. The bottom part of the wing is square and attached to the bottom segment.

    Step 3

    Draw identical wings on the right side.

    Step 4

    Add some oval patterns on the top part of the left wing.

    Step 5

    Continue adding smaller oval and circle patterns on the top part of the left wing.

    Step 6

    Now draw some oval patterns on the bottom part of the wing. These lines start at the top corner of the bottom wing.

    Step 7

    Continue adding smaller circular textures on the bottom outer part of the wing.

    Step 8

    Draw oval patterns on the top part of the right wing. Try to make these patterns a mirror image of the ones you drew on the left side.

    Step 9

    Continue adding smaller circular patterns on the outermost part of the right wing.

    Step 10

    Draw some oval patterns in the bottom part of the right wing. Do your best to make them an exact mirror image of the patterns on the left wing.

    Step 11

    Continue drawing smaller circular patterns on the bottom outer part of the right wing.

    Step 12

    Finally, draw two curved lines to make the antenna from the top part of the body. Color your butterfly.

    How to draw a rainbow heart

    Please see the drawing tutorial in the video below

    You can refer to the simple step-by-step drawing guide below

    Step 1

    Start by drawing an upside down isosceles triangle – a triangle with two equal side lengths.

    Step 2

    Draw a vertical line, extending from the bottom point of the triangle, through the top line.

    Step 3

    Draw a curved line on the left side of the triangle. The line should curve into a triangle near the bottom and outside the triangle near the top.

    Step 4

    Repeat this process to create a mirror image on the right side.

    Step 5

    Draw a circle that cuts the left side of the triangle. It should be placed between the curve and the vertical line.

    Step 6

    Repeat this process to create a mirror image on the other side.

    Step 7

    Erase guides from within the shape. You now have a perfectly formed heart.

    Step 8

    Similarly draw smaller heart shapes inside the heart just drawn.

    Step 9

    Fill in rainbow colors for the hearts.
